RYFF, CONFECT BUCH AND HOUSE APOTECK, 1571 with woodcuts, (lacking title).
(RYFF, WALTER HERMANN. Confect Buch und Hauss Apoteck, Kunstlich zubereiten, einmachen und gebrauchen, Wes in Ordenlichen Apotecken und Hausshaltungen zur Artznei, taglicher notturfft unnd auch zum lust dienlich und nutz Trewlich underrichtung. Frankfurt am Main, C. Egenolff Erben 1571.).
Small 8vo (binding). 2-344, (7) ll. Lacking the title. With woodcuts in the text.
Contemporary blindtooled pigskin binding on wooden boards, with metal clasps and fittings, lacking lower clasp, spine in compartments, partly worn, soiled and rubbed, some stains, small damage to upper and lower part of spine. Throughout stain to upper part of text. Some other staining and spotting.
VD 16, R 3933.
One of the most popular German house books of the 16th century. The first edition was published in 1540.
Provenance: Sven Borgström was born in Malmö in 1927 and worked as a chemist in Stockholm, Malmö and Lund. His fine library which was built up over many years, consists mainly of older books dated from the 15th century to the late 18th century.
His book-collecting began, as it perhaps should, with an incunabula. Borgström's interests included printers, book bindings, book illustrations, and he was interested in history, travel and maps. As a result of previous coin collecting, the subject of numismatics was also of interest in his library. Sven Borgström died 95 years old.Show more
